摘要
Both of a series of new second generation carbosilane dendrimers having a different number of branches (Me(n)G 2-Mesogen, n=1, 2, 3) and a novel carbosilane dendrimer having an increased length of methylene chain from the core to the second generation (Gradient G 2-Mesogen) with terminal cyanobiphenyl mesogens were prepared. The characterization of the dendrimers was carried out by using differential scanning calorimetry (DSC) and optical polarizing microscopy. All the dendrimers showed smectic A phase. The ranges of the smectic A phase and the texture size of Me(n)G 2-Mesogen were increased with increasing the number of branches. The behavior of phase transition temperature and the texture size of Gradient G 2-Mesogen were similar to those of Me(n)G-2 Mesogen.
